The Vendor Evaluation Test

When evaluating any vendor for enterprise readiness, apply these concrete tests.

  • Scale test: Ask the vendor to process 1,000 documents in a single batch during your evaluation. Monitor speed and accuracy across the entire batch, not just the first 10.
  • Security test: Request SOC 2 Type II compliance documentation. SOC 2 validates that security controls operate effectively over time, not just that they exist on paper (Venn SOC 2 Guide).
  • Integration test: Ask for REST API documentation, code snippets in your language, and webhook support. If you get "coming soon," walk away.
  • Multi-tenant test: Verify that Department A truly cannot see Department B's documents, workflows, or results.

What "Hidden Costs" Really Mean

When enterprises calculate the cost of manual document processing, they typically account for direct labor: salaries, benefits, and desk space for verification staff. But research shows that for every $1 in direct labor, businesses incur an additional $2.30-$4.70 in hidden costs:

  • Rework costs — Documents rejected for data entry errors that need to be reprocessed
  • Delay costs — Revenue delayed because verification is stuck in a queue
  • Error costs — Incorrect data entered into systems, causing downstream problems in lending, insurance, or onboarding
  • Compliance costs — Failed audits, remediation programs, and regulatory penalties from inconsistent verification
  • Opportunity costs — Skilled employees spending time on repetitive tasks instead of high-value work

An enterprise processing 5,000 documents per month isn't spending $30,000 on manual verification. They're spending $100,000-$170,000 when hidden costs are included.

How AI Powers Modern Document Verification

Automated document verification in 2026 isn't a single technology. It's a layered AI stack where each layer handles a specific aspect of the verification process:

📄

Layer 1: Intelligent Data Extraction

AI OCR + NLP reads text, tables, handwriting from any document format. Understands context: "12,500" in "Total Amount" field is the invoice total. Achieves 95-99% accuracy on printed text.

📁

Layer 2: Document Classification

ML auto-identifies document type — PAN, Aadhaar, invoice, bank statement. Classifies in milliseconds and routes to the right verification workflow. Eliminates manual sorting.

🔎

Layer 3: Fraud Detection

Computer vision analyzes pixel-level patterns, font consistency, metadata anomalies. Detects digital photo swaps, text edits, AI-generated forgeries. Fraud attempts surged 180% in 2025.

🌐

Layer 4: Government DB Cross-Verification

Verifies extracted data against issuing authority's database in real time. A forged document may fool image analysis — but it cannot fool a live database check. The definitive layer.

Layer 1: Intelligent Data Extraction (OCR + NLP)

What it does: Reads text, tables, handwriting, and structured fields from any document format like PDFs, scanned images, photos, and even faxes.

How it works: Modern AI OCR goes far beyond character recognition. It uses natural language processing (NLP) to understand context. For example, when processing an invoice, it doesn't just read "12,500". It understands that this number appears in the "Total Amount" field, is denominated in INR, and represents the sum of the line items above it.

Accuracy benchmarks: AI-powered extraction achieves 95-99% accuracy on printed text and 85-95% on handwritten documents — a 67% improvement over traditional OCR for complex document formats (Firstsource).

Layer 2: Document Classification (Machine Learning)

What it does: Automatically identifies the document type — PAN card, Aadhaar, invoice, bank statement, employment letter — without requiring the user to specify.

How it works: ML models trained on millions of document samples recognize visual patterns, layouts, logos, and content structures. When a new document arrives, the system classifies it in milliseconds and routes it to the appropriate verification workflow.

Why it matters: In bulk processing scenarios (e.g., processing 500 employee onboarding documents), automatic classification eliminates the manual step of sorting documents by type before verification begins.

Layer 3: Fraud and Tampering Detection (Computer Vision)

What it does: Identifies signs of document alteration, digital manipulation, or AI-generated forgery.

How it works: AI analyzes pixel-level patterns, font consistency, compression artifacts, metadata anomalies, and visual authenticity markers. It can detect when a photo has been digitally swapped on an ID card, when text has been edited in a certificate, or when an entire document has been generated using AI tools.

Why it matters: Sophisticated fraud attempts surged 180% in 2025, and AI-generated document forgeries are rising rapidly. Human reviewers cannot detect pixel-level manipulation — AI can.

Layer 4: Government Database Cross-Verification (API Integration)

What it does: Takes the data extracted from a document and verifies it against the issuing authority's database in real time.

How it works: After extracting a PAN number from a document, the system calls the Income Tax Department's verification API to confirm the number is valid, matches the holder's name, and is currently active. This happens in seconds, without human intervention.

Why it matters: A forged document might fool visual inspection and even AI-based image analysis. But it cannot fool a live database check. This is the definitive layer of verification.

Layer 5: Agentic AI Workflow Orchestration

What it does: Coordinates all four layers above into intelligent, multi-step verification pipelines that make decisions based on results.

How it works: Agentic AI doesn't just follow a linear sequence. It evaluates results at each step and routes the document accordingly:

  • If the document passes all checks → Auto-approve and deliver to downstream system
  • If extraction confidence is below 80% → Route to human reviewer
  • If database verification returns a mismatch → Flag for fraud investigation
  • If a conditional threshold is triggered (e.g., loan amount > ₹50 lakh) → Escalate to senior approval

The Government API Advantage — Real-Time Database Verification

Here's a truth that most document verification vendors won't tell you: document-level verification alone is not enough.

A beautifully printed PAN card that passes every image forensics test is still fraudulent if the PAN number doesn't exist in the Income Tax Department's database. A GSTIN printed on a vendor's letterhead is meaningless if it's been cancelled or belongs to a different entity.

The only way to confirm that a document's contents are authentic is to verify against the issuing authority's records. And in India, that means government database APIs.

What Is Document Verification Software?

Document verification software is an enterprise technology platform that uses artificial intelligence, machine learning, and natural language processing to automatically extract, validate, authenticate and verify information from documents - then cross-reference that data against authoritative databases in real time.

Think of it as the difference between a security guard checking IDs by eye at a gate versus a system that instantly scans the document, reads every field, verifies it against the issuing government database, checks for signs of tampering, and flags anomalies - all in under 10 seconds.

What Document Verification Software Actually Does

Modern document verification platforms handle four core functions:

Function What It Does Example
Data Extraction AI-powered OCR + NLP reads text, tables, and fields from PDFs, images, and scanned documents Extracting vendor name, invoice number, and line items from 500 invoices in 10 minutes
Document Authentication AI image forensics detect tampering, forgery, and alterations Identifying a digitally altered PAN card where the photo has been swapped
Database Verification Real-time cross-referencing against government and third-party databases Verifying a GSTIN number against the GST portal to confirm active status
Workflow Automation Conditional routing, approvals, and actions based on verification results Auto-approving KYC applications that pass all checks, flagging exceptions for human review

The Evolution: From Manual Checks to Agentic AI

Document verification has evolved through three distinct generations:

Generation 1: Manual Verification (Pre-2015)

Teams of clerks physically inspected documents, compared signatures, and called issuing authorities by phone. Accuracy was inconsistent, and processing a single document could take hours.

Generation 2: Template-Based OCR (2015-2022)

Software could scan documents and extract text using optical character recognition, but required rigid templates for each document type and couldn't handle variations, multi-language content, or verification logic.

Generation 3: Agentic AI Verification (2023-Present)

Today's platforms use agentic AI - intelligent systems that don't just follow rules, but make decisions based on what they find. They extract data from any document format, verify it against live databases, apply conditional logic, flag exceptions, and route documents through multi-step workflows - all without human intervention.

1. Document Fraud Has Become AI-Powered

The threat landscape has fundamentally shifted. According to Sumsub's 2025 Annual Report:

  • Sophisticated fraud attempts surged 180% - from 10% of all fraud in 2024 to 28% in 2025
  • AI-assisted document forgery rose to 2% of all fake documents detected, up from 0% the prior year
  • Deepfake selfies increased 58%, making biometric-only verification insufficient
  • AI fraud agents - automated systems that create synthetic identities and interact with verification platforms in real time - are expected to become mainstream within 18 months

Fraudsters now use tools like ChatGPT, Grok, and Gemini to generate convincing fake documents. ID cards represent 72% of forged documents, followed by passports (13%) and driver's licenses (10%).

Manual verification teams simply cannot detect AI-generated forgeries at the speed and scale enterprises require.

Questions to Ask During Vendor Demos

  1. "Can you run our actual documents through the system live, right now?"
  2. "What happens when the system encounters a document type it hasn't seen before?"
  3. "Show me how a conditional workflow works - if document X fails verification, what happens next?"
  4. "What is your average API response time for government database verifications?"
  5. "How do you handle document types with variable layouts?"
  6. "Can I export audit trail data for regulatory compliance reporting?"

Pilot/POC Best Practices

  • Start with a defined use case - Don't try to automate everything at once. Pick your highest-volume, highest-pain verification workflow.
  • Use real documents - Test with actual documents from your operations, not sample data.
  • Measure before and after - Document current processing time, error rates, and costs so you can calculate actual ROI.
  • Involve end users - Let the people who will use the system daily participate in the evaluation.
  • Set success criteria upfront - Define what "success" looks like before the pilot starts (e.g., 95%+ accuracy, under 30 seconds per document, 10,000 documents processed without errors).

What is the difference between document verification and document validation?

Document validation confirms that a document's format, structure, and fields are correct - for example, checking that a PAN card has 10 characters in the correct alphanumeric pattern. Document verification goes further by confirming that the document's content is authentic and matches official records - for example, verifying that the PAN number belongs to the person named on the card by checking against the Income Tax Department's database.
